Global Market: Japan's Takaichi unveils growth blueprint, reiterates investment push amid bond market concerns
Japanese Prime Minister Sanae Takaichi has released her first economic blueprint, which focuses on increasing investment in strategic sectors. The plan aims to boost long-term growth while maintaining the Bank of Japan's independent monetary policy.
This announcement is significant for investors as it comes during a period of volatility in global markets. Rising bond yields and concerns over government spending have created uncertainty. Takaichi's commitment to fiscal discipline and the BOJ's autonomy is intended to reassure investors and stabilize the financial environment.
Investors should monitor how the government plans to fund these strategic investments without increasing debt. Additionally, watch for any reactions from the Bank of Japan regarding its policy stance as bond yields continue to fluctuate.
